 How Significant Is The Future Market Potential Of The Medical Device Subscription Market Based On Its Projected Size And Growth Rate?

The medical device subscription market size has grown exponentially in recent years. It will grow from $9.01 billion in 2025 to $11.06 billion in 2026 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 22.8%. The growth in the historic period can be attributed to high upfront device costs, rising hospital adoption, increasing device complexity, demand for managed services, growth of healthcare IT integration.

The medical device subscription market size is expected to see exponential growth in the next few years. It will grow to $24.89 billion in 2030 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 22.5%. The growth in the forecast period can be attributed to expansion of remote monitoring services, AI-driven device management, increased adoption in emerging markets, demand for customized subscription models, integration with telehealth solutions. Major trends in the forecast period include recurring healthcare device services, predictive maintenance, remote patient monitoring, flexible subscription models, homecare device integration.

Which Major Drivers Are Strengthening Demand In The Medical Device Subscription Market?

The growing emphasis on remote patient monitoring is expected to propel the growth of the medical device subscription market going forward. Remote patient monitoring refers to the use of digital technologies to collect and transmit patients’ health data from outside traditional healthcare settings to healthcare providers for assessment and guidance. The emphasis on remote patient monitoring is increasing because there is a growing need for continuous healthcare management to track patients’ health in real time, improve outcomes, and reduce hospital visits. Medical device subscription supports remote patient monitoring by providing patients and healthcare providers with continuous access to advanced medical devices and digital tools through flexible, subscription-based models, enabling real-time data collection, seamless health tracking, and proactive care management without the burden of high upfront costs. For instance, in August 2023, according to Vivalink, a US-based healthcare technology company, a recent survey revealed that 84% of respondents currently using RPM plan to increase their usage in 2024, 45% of providers utilize RPM for acute monitoring such as hospital-at-home programs, and 77% predict that RPM-based care will outpace traditional in-patient hospital care within the next five years. Therefore, the growing emphasis on remote patient monitoring is driving the growth of the medical device subscription market.

What Key Market Trends Are Contributing To The Ongoing Development Of The Medical Device Subscription Market?

Major companies operating in the medical device subscription market are focusing on developing innovative products such as advanced health wearables to enhance remote health monitoring and improve personalized wellness management. Advanced health wearables are smart devices equipped with sensors that continuously track and analyze body functions, helping users monitor their health in real time, detect potential issues early, and make informed wellness decisions. For instance, in May 2025, WHOOP Inc., a US-based medical technology company, launched the Whoop 5.0 and Whoop MG, two next-generation health wearables designed to provide continuous, medical-grade monitoring. The devices feature capabilities such as on-demand ECGs, blood pressure tracking, hormonal insights, and advanced recovery analytics, all integrated within a tiered subscription model that includes options like Whoop One, Peak, and Life. These wearables not only help users monitor their strain, sleep, and recovery metrics, but also leverage AI-driven insights to deliver personalized recommendations for optimizing performance and long-term wellness. This launch marks the company’s entry into the medical-grade wearable category, bridging the gap between fitness tracking and clinical health assessment. Through continuous physiological monitoring and real-time data sharing, the platform supports early detection of potential health issues, enabling users and healthcare professionals to make more informed decisions.

Which Regions Stand Out As Major Contributors To Future Demand In The Medical Device Subscription Market?

North America was the largest region in the medical device subscription market in 2025. Asia-Pacific is expected to be the fastest-growing region in the forecast period.
